    Content creator Iyo raises alarm over alleged kidnapping by man in police uniform

    • Nigerian sketch producer Iyo shared a disturbing experience on Instagram.
    • He claimed that he was forcibly taken away by people he claimed to be police officers.
    • The incident happened on his way to the gym.

    Nigerian skit producer and content creator Iyo has recounted a disturbing experience involving someone he claimed was a police officer.

    In a statement shared on his Instagram page, Iyo claimed that the incident happened while he was on his way to the gym. He claimed he was forcibly taken away by some men who arrived on a bus.

    According to him, the men were wearing police uniforms and carrying weapons. Iyo further claimed that he was attacked and suffered rib injuries during the ordeal, while his phone was also confiscated.

    He claimed they demanded £6 million and hacked into his bank account, draining all the money in it. Idai said he was later taken to another local government area where the money was withdrawn and he was eventually abandoned in a bushy area.

    In another post, the content creator shared another account from someone who claimed to have experienced a similar situation. The man claimed £2 million had been stolen from his account and said there were five people in the minibus he was forced to travel in.

    Reacting to these incidents, Iyo expressed frustration and concern, claiming that those sent to protect citizens were instead responsible for abducting them.

    The skit maker’s claims add to growing reports of celebrities’ run-ins with law enforcement. While some public figures have previously been invited for questioning and released, others have faced more serious situations, including temporary detention.

    Just recently, Nollywood actress Angela Okorie was reportedly arrested and arraigned by the police, with images and details of the case later circulating online.
